The U.S. Army Program Executive Office Command, Control, Communications and Network — Tactical (PEO C3T), International IT Systems (IITS) office issued a Sources Sought / Request for Information seeking non-personal Systems Engineering and Technical Assistance (SETA) to provide Program Management Office Support (PMOS) for Allied Information Technology (PL AIT). Required services include program and project management, FMS case management across the case lifecycle, systems engineering, cybersecurity technical support, logistics and sustainment planning, acquisition/procurement analysis, and financial management to support global C5I capability delivery to partner nations. This notice is identified as an 8(a) set-aside with NAICS 541330 and place of performance at Fort Belvoir, VA.

This is a Request for Information (RFI) issued by the Air Force Life Cycle Management Center (AFLCMC) seeking Battlespace Command and Control Center (BC3) software capabilities (including MSCT software licenses and BC3 extensions) to support the Cloud Based Command and Control (CBC2) program within the Advanced Battle Management System (ABMS) effort. The government requests information on software licensing, system development and integration support, participation in integration/workshops/tests, cybersecurity, helpdesk support, and delivery of minimum Government Purpose Rights for data/software. Responses are due by Feb 9, 2026 (noon EST) and the solicitation is an RFI (not a grant).
